In recent years, Apple has been remarkably good at simultaneously making its products available across multiple territories. It has been less impressive with pricing opnness especially where third parties are involved. Nevertheless, it is still surprising that Apple is not planning to tell anyone the pricing for its iPad until its launch later this month.
Equally as frustrating is a lack of clarity as to when the iBook service will be available and of course what the selection will be like in the UK. Currently Apple is only committing to a US launch.
This all matters to us because the iPad is a potentially game-changing device for cultural spaces but only if it is reasonably priced and sufficiently specced to get an audience.
